How to Use Data Analytics for Sports Betting
Utilising data analytics may seem daunting at first, but breaking it down into manageable steps makes it easier:
- Identify Key Statistics: Focus on metrics such as team performance, player injuries, historical match outcomes, and weather conditions.
- Utilise Betting Models: Create or adopt models that predict outcomes based on historical data. Common models include Poisson regression and Elo ratings.
- Track Your Bets: Maintain a detailed record of your bets to identify trends over time. This includes win rates, profit margins, and types of bets placed.
- Read Expert Analyses: Follow trusted analysts and platforms that provide comprehensive breakdowns and predictions based on data.
- Stay Updated: Ensure that you are using the most current information, including player transfers and changes in management.
